Blizzard's Cancelled Point 'N' Click Game, Warcraft Adventures: Lord of the Clans, Leaked


Warcraft Adventures: Lord of the Clans is a point 'n' click game that Blizzard cancelled in 1998. It's an adventure charting the origins of Horde hero, Thrall. This weekend, the game was leaked in its entirety, but the file has already been pulled, and the file is no longer available for download.

The leak was posted by Reidor on the Scrolls of Lore forums, and contains a "full pre-released version with in-game cinematics". Blizzard did not comment on the leak, but they might have already taken action to take it down.

The game was a hand-drawn point 'n' click made to add humanity and humor to the series, with the goal to make the Orc faction more relatable and sympathetic.

But after several days, Blizzard cancelled the game days before its E3 1998 presentation, seeing it as inferior to LucasArts' Curse of Monkey Island.
